What Domestic Cleaning Typically Includes

Kitchen and bathroom domestic cleaning in NW8 residential property

Every home is different, so a proper cleaning service should be tailored rather than rigid. That said, most customers in NW8 expect a thorough routine clean that covers the main living areas, plus the rooms that tend to accumulate dirt fastest. The goal is to keep the property presentable, hygienic, and comfortable without making you explain the basics every single visit.

Typical tasks can include dusting, vacuuming, mopping, wiping surfaces, cleaning kitchen sinks and worktops, bathroom sanitising, and removing visible marks from doors, switches, and fittings. Attention often goes to high-touch areas such as handles, taps, and light switches, because these are the places that quickly make a home feel less fresh.

Many clients also like to include small but valuable extras, such as tidying soft furnishings, refreshing bin areas, cleaning around appliances, and making beds. These details may seem minor, but together they make a noticeable difference to how the home feels when you walk through the door.

Common cleaning tasks in a standard visit

  • Dusting furniture, shelves, skirting boards, and accessible surfaces
  • Vacuuming carpets, rugs, stairs, and upholstery areas
  • Mopping hard floors in kitchens, hallways, and bathrooms
  • Cleaning sinks, taps, hobs, splashbacks, and worktops
  • Wiping bathroom fixtures, tiles, mirrors, and external surfaces
  • Emptying bins and replacing liners where requested
  • General room refresh and light tidying

Regular Cleaning, One-Off Cleans, and Deep Cleans

Regular home cleaning visit for a flat in NW8 with local access considerations

Not every customer needs the same type of service. Some households want weekly or fortnightly visits to keep on top of chores. Others need a one-off clean after builders, before a family event, or when they have fallen behind and want the home brought back under control. Understanding the difference between service types helps you choose the right option from the start.

A regular domestic cleaning arrangement is usually best for homes that need ongoing upkeep. This is the most practical choice for many NW8 residents, especially in busy flats and family homes where cleaning tasks build up steadily through the week. Regular visits keep surfaces manageable, bathrooms fresher, and floors easier to maintain.

A one-off clean is more intensive and is often used when the home needs a reset. It can be useful before hosting visitors, after illness, after a busy period, or whenever you want a deeper clean without committing to a schedule. A deep cleaning session goes further and may focus on built-up areas such as behind appliances, limescale-prone fittings, detailed skirting, or neglected corners.

Which option suits your home?

If you are not sure, think about your lifestyle and property type:

  1. Weekly or fortnightly cleaning suits busy households, rental flats, and homes with children or pets.
  2. One-off cleaning is useful when you need the home restored to a fresh standard quickly.
  3. Deep cleaning is often chosen for seasonal resets, moving-in support, or heavily used properties.

For many local customers, the right answer is a combination: regular domestic cleaning for everyday upkeep, with occasional deeper visits when needed.

Pricing Factors and What Influences the Cost

Customers often want to know what affects the cost of domestic cleaning, and it is sensible to ask. Without quoting exact prices, it helps to understand the main factors that typically shape a quote. In NW8, the price can vary depending on property size, the frequency of visits, the level of cleaning required, and access arrangements.

A small flat that is cleaned regularly may take less time than a larger family home that has not been cleaned for a while. Similarly, a simple routine visit will usually differ from a deep clean involving detailed work in kitchens, bathrooms, and hard-to-reach places. Buildings with difficult access, parking restrictions, or limited entry windows may also affect planning and time on site.

It is also common for customers to request add-on tasks. For example, some want inside oven cleaning, inside fridge cleaning, or extra time on certain rooms. These requests can be reasonable and often useful, but they should be discussed in advance so the service can be priced and scheduled properly.

Typical factors that influence a quote

  1. Property size and number of rooms
  2. Frequency of cleaning visits
  3. Condition of the home and level of build-up
  4. Access, parking, and entry arrangements
  5. Any extra tasks beyond a standard clean
  6. Time required for special surfaces or careful handling

Professional domestic cleaners use a structured system that helps them clean faster and more thoroughly than most DIY routines. They work room by room, use colour-coded cloths to reduce cross-contamination, and follow checklists to make sure nothing is missed. Trusted domestic cleaners typically use industry-standard equipment such as HEPA-filter vacuum cleaners, microfiber cloths, steam cleaners, mop systems, and professional-grade, surface-safe detergents. Many also use colour-coded tools to separate kitchen, bathroom, and general cleaning tasks. Domestic cleaning usually refers to regular maintenance cleaning that keeps a home tidy and hygienic from week to week. Deep cleaning is more detailed and tackles hidden dirt, limescale, grease, and built-up grime in areas like skirting boards, behind appliances, and inside cupboards.
